These are оnе of thе most common pests on succulents and сасti. Thеу аrе tinу, elliptical inѕесtѕ аbоut 2-3 millimеtеrѕ lоng, grау оr light brown in color. They gеt thеir name frоm a waxy оr mealy white mаtеriаl they рrоduсе.
Aside from being the most common of cacti-eating pests, mealybugs are also quite difficult to get rid of and is nearly impossible to do so without the use of a systemic pesticide. Contact insecticides will kill mealybugs, but do have to be added in fairly high concentration due to the protective covering that the insect makes for itself.

Although most problems associated with cacti and succulents grown as houseplants are bacterial or fungal diseases caused by overwatering, they do get the occasional insect pest. The most common pests are scale, mealy bugs and root mealy bugs.
Scales are little insects in a variety of over 7,900 breeds, which attach themselves underneath the hard shells of succulent plants. They burrow underneath and attach like leeches, sucking the moisture out of plants.

Broad mites and cyclamen mites are less common pests, but they can do considerable damage to the growing tips of plants. They are too tiny to see with the eye, but if the tips of your houseplant start looking stunted, distorted, or the leaves start curling, you can suspect mites are there.

While the adults can cause damage to the leaves, the grubs of vine weevils are the root cause of damage to many succulent collections. Crassula, echeveria, and kalanchoe plants are the most susceptible to these pests.
